Formula

δ ≈ 23.44° sin(2π (N−81)/365),   h_noon ≈ 90° − |φ − δ|

Valid for a quick estimation near solar noon. For hourly positions, account for hour angle and equation of time.

How accurate is this?

Typically within a couple of degrees at noon. For precise solar angles use full solar position algorithms.
